OEM Carrier Transformer 40VA 120V to 24V for Model GA1AAD036050AAJA

This OEM control circuit transformer (part# HT01BC116) is the factory-specified replacement for the Carrier GA1AAD036050AAJA packaged unit. The transformer steps down 120V line voltage to the 24V signal voltage that powers your thermostat, control board, contactor coil, and every other low-voltage control component in the system. When it fails, absolutely nothing works — the thermostat goes dark, the system won't respond to any call for heating or cooling, and you may find a blown fuse on the control board from a secondary-side short. This is one of the first components to check during a no-power, no-communication diagnostic.

How do I replace the transformer on my Carrier GA1AAD036050AAJA?
Difficulty: Medium (30–45 min)
Step 1: Turn off breaker. Step 2: Photo wiring connections. Step 3: Disconnect wires from old transformer. Step 4: Remove mounting hardware. Step 5: Install new transformer, reconnect wires matching voltage ratings. Step 6: Verify 24V output with multimeter.
My thermostat has no power. What failed?
Thermostat with no display = failed 24V transformer (or blown control board fuse). Check the 3A/5A fuse on the control board first ($1–$5 fix). If fuse is good but no 24V output from transformer, replace transformer.
